JPS says access issues have left some areas without electricity after expiration of restoration deadline

The Jamaica Public Service Company says it has completed post-Beryl restoration of electricity to the majority of its customers, except for some in St Elizabeth and isolated areas of Westmoreland, Manchester and rural St Andrew. The JPS had...
